Transaction 43fabca90ee823f07041e33de47f9a71c1f5a6f46016eeb40b269d830d8abd5e

2 Input
2 Outputs
  • 43fabca90ee823f07041e33de47f9a71c1f5a6f46016eeb40b269d830d8abd5e:0
  • value  307000
    address  18QneoT2PPEj7W3F91iDusCY1FW7pvTThz
  • 43fabca90ee823f07041e33de47f9a71c1f5a6f46016eeb40b269d830d8abd5e:1
  • value  12461
    address  138okod72M1k7nuXr5LBqz5xD6ZWYsJHdT